When
the US Marine Corps sought custom solutions for
maintenance of heavy equipment at their 29 Palms
location, Big Top Manufacturing provided two
unique types of structures. One shelter is customized
to house wash racks for the washing of large
trucks and heavy equipment. The 36Wx60Lx 29H
shelter helps prevent harmful UV rays from effecting
equipment.
|
|
Big
Top provided a second custom solution by connecting
three shelters using ISO containers as a shared
foundation. The three-unit building provides
an ideal
maintenance and storage area for heavy equipment, while the container foundation
saved the client money. The largest of the three units is 44 feet wide, while
the side units are each 28 feet wide. The three-unit building solution also includes
custom roll up doors. |

| Big
Top client, Matson Navigation, requested two
large shelters to be installed on their cargo
transport ships The Greatland and Lurline. The
Greatland structure was an 18,400 sq ft. structure
and the Lurline was 21,000 sq ft. Both were used
to dock large car transport ships. The shelters
were custom designed to protect cars from the
ships' exhaust acid as well as withstand high
wind speeds. Although used to transport cars
from Seattle to Hawaii, the installation took
place in China. Project was completed with accelerated
lead time -- project was completed within six
weeks of order. |

| The
Hugo Neu/Schnitzer East Steel structure uses large
steel ISO containers
as a foundation, which saved the client a considerable
amount of money for construction. Built in an environmentally
sensitive area, the fabric shelter construction
helped negate issues associated with building permits
and increased property taxes. |
